ImmunoStrip for Hosta virus X

Acronym: HVX
Group: Potexvirus
Vector: mechanical

Hosta virus X (HVX) is a damaging and prevalent virus of hosta potentially capable of infecting all varieties. Hosta is the only known host of HVX at this time. The virus is spread mechanically by contaminated tools, hands or any activity that puts plants in contact with infected plant sap. HVX is not thought to be spread by insects or nematodes. Some Hosta varieties are more susceptible to HVX than others. Symptoms are quite variable among varieties with some plants showing no symptoms at all.  There is no treatment for virus infected plants. The only control method is to purchase and propagate from non-infected plants and identify and destroy any existing infected plants.

The HVX ImmunoStrip® is an on-site tool to quickly identify plants infected with HVX. It can be used to test leaves and roots. The test is based on antibodies developed by Dr. Ben Lockhart of the University of Minnesota who first identified and characterized the virus. The test was validated using over 35 different varieties of Hosta. Several HVX isolates were tested including isolates from Dr. Lockhart and from several infected plants of commercial production sites.
